The speaker shares their journey after brain surgery, exploring brain science and experimenting with chemical dosages to regain intelligence and creativity. They discuss the role of mental images in creative thinking and highlight recent advancements in brain imaging technology. The talk concludes with the potential of brain-computer interfaces to revolutionize communication and possibly cure diseases like Alzheimer's.
